1985 Iroc 5-speed, t-top

I recently purchased a 85 iroc to convert to race car but came across a better deal so I am putting this up for sale...

Its a 1985 iroc with original 5-speed and 305 (carb) and has t-tops with 96k miles. Previous owner said new clutch was installed. I drove the car before i bought it and it ran strong. once i got it home i couldnt get it to idle, had to keep on gas until it warms up and then it seems to idle better. I dont know anything about carbs and dont have time to check it out much.

i drive it and just help with the idle and it runs strong other than the idle issue.

car used to be blue but is not is in primer, previous owner primed entire car. there is some small rust damage on the rear fenders, t-tops dont leak (glass and comes with bag). has 91-92 gfx front and sides. and has a 4 in cowl hood. previous owner did a crap job installing it so i'll throw in my 1992 z28 hood with it (doesnt have any mounting hardware though). has a new black carpet that is not installed yet, its sitting trunk. Car has an overhead console and a spare overhead console that you could sell as well.

driver door hinge needs replaced but the door still opens/closes and locks. has no heat/ac, no radio. it has 4 wheel disc brakes as well. drive seat is a crappy racing seat that i'll replace with good cloth seats from my 92z.

"G" Car - easy way to tell.... eight digit of the vin is a "G", which signified it was a 305 HO (L69) carbed engine with factory 5 speed, and 3.73 Gears. Providing the car is a true IROC (which I would have no reason to doubt you) the RPO sheet should match the vin and have B4Z on the sheet. If that is in fact true then the car is some what of a rarity being there were only 2,497 IROC-Z "G" car produced in 85 and only 74 produced in 86 totaling 2571 ever produced.
